Bachelors Degree B.Tech R18

II-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S301ESAnalog and Digital Electronics3003
2CS302PCData Structures3104
3MA303BSComputer Oriented Statistical Methods3104
4CS304PCComputer Organization and Architecture3003
5CS305PCObject Oriented Programming using C++2002
6CS306ESAnalog and Digital Electronics Lab0021
7CS307PCData Structures Lab0031.5
8CS308PCIT Workshop Lab0031.5
9CS309PCC++ Programming Lab0021
10*MC309Gender Sensitization Lab0020
  Total Credits1521221
II-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S401PCDiscrete Mathematics3003
2SM402MSBusiness Economics & Financial Analysis3003
3CS403PCOperating System3003
4CS404PCDatabase Management Systems3104
5CS405PCJava Programming3104
6CS406PCOperating Systems Lab0031.5
7CS407PCDatabase Management Systems Lab0031.5
8CS408PCJava Programming Lab0021
9*MC409Constitution of India3000
  Total Credits182821
III-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S501PCFormal Languages & Automata Theory3003
2CS502PCSoftware Engineering3003
3CS503PCComputer Networks3003
4CS504PCWeb Technologies3003
5CS511PE
CS512PE
CS513PE
CS514PE
CS515PE
Professional Elective-I
Information Theory & Coding
Advanced Computer Architecture
Data Analytics
Image Processing
Principles of Programming Languages
3003
6CS521PE
CS522PE
CS523PE
CS524PE
CS525PE
Professional Elective -II
Computer Graphics
Advanced Operating Systems
Informational Retrieval Systems
Distributed Databases
Natural Language Processing
3003
7CS505PCSoftware Engineering Lab0031.5
8CS506PCComputer Networks & Web Technologies Lab0031.5
9EN508HSAdvanced Communication Skills Lab0021
10*MC510Intellectual Property Rights3000
11 Artificial Intelligence3000
  Total Credits240822
III-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S601PCMachine Learning3104
2CS602PCCompiler Design3104
3CS603PCDesign and Analysis of Algorithms3104
4CS611PE
CS612PE
CS613PE
CS614PE
CS615PE
Professional Elective-III
Concurrent Programming
Network Programming
Scripting Languages
Mobile Application Development
Software Testing Methodologies
3003
5 Open Elective-I3003
6CS604PCMachine Learning Lab0031.5
7CS605PCCompiler Design Lab0031.5
8CS621PE
CS622PE
CS623PE
CS624PE
CS625PE
Professional Elective-III Lab
Concurrent Programming
Network Programming
Scripting Languages
Mobile Application Development
Software Testing Methodologies
0021
9*MC609Environmental Science3000
10 Cyber Security3000
  Total Credits213822
IV-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S701PCCryptography & Network Security3003
2CS702PCData Mining2002
3CS711PE
CS712PE
CS713PE
CS714PE
CS715PE
Professional Elective-IV
Graph Theory
Introduction to Embedded Systems
Artificial Intelligence
Cloud Computing
Ad-hoc & Sensor Networks
3003
4CS721PE
CS722PE
CS723PE
CS724PE
CS725PE
Professional Elective-V
Advanced Algorithms
Real Time Systems
Soft Computing
Internet of Things
Software Process & Project Management
3003
5 Open Elective-II3003
6CS703PCCryptography & Network Security Lab0021
7CS704PCIndustrial Oriented Mini Project/ Summer Internship0002*
8CS705PCSeminar0021
9CS706PCProject Stage – I0063
  Total Credits1401021

Note: Industrial Oriented Mini Project/ Summer Internship is to be carried out during the summer
vacation between 6th and 7th semesters. Students should submit report of Industrial Oriented Mini
Project/ Summer Internship for evaluation.

IV-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1SM801MSOrganizational Behaviour3003
2CS811PE
CS812PE
CS813PE
CS814PE
CS815PE
Professional Elective-VI
Computational Complexity
Distributed Systems
Neural Networks & Deep Learning
Human Computer Interaction
Cyber Forensics
3003
3 Open Elective – III3003
4CS802PCProject Stage – II00147
  Total Credits901416

Bachelors Degree B.Tech R16

II-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1MA301BSMathematics – IV4104
2CS302ESData Structures through C++4004
3CS303ESMathematical Foundations of Computer Science4004
4CS304ESDigital Logic Design3003
5CS305ESObject Oriented Programming through Java3003
6CS306ESData Structures through C++ Lab0032
7CS307ESIT Workshop0032
8CS308ESObject Oriented Programming through Java Lab0032
9* MC300ESEnvironmental Science and Technology3000
  Total Credits211924
II-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S401BSComputer Organization4004
2CS402ESDatabase Management Systems4004
3CS403ESOperating System4004
4CS404ESFormal Languages and Automata Theory3003
5SM405MSBusiness Economics and Financial Analysis3003
6CS406ESComputer Organization Lab0032
7CS407ESDatabase Management Systems Lab0032
8CS308ESOperating Systems Lab0032
9* MC400HSGender Sensitization Lab0030
  Total Credits1801224
III-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S501PCDesign and Analysis of Algorithms4004
2CS502PCData Communication and Computer Networks4004
3CS503PCSoftware Engineering4004
4SM504MSFundamentals of Management3003
5 Open Elective –I3003
6CS505PCDesign and Analysis of Algorithms Lab0032
7CS506PCComputer Networks Lab0032
8CS507PCSoftware Engineering Lab0032
9*MC500HSProfessional Ethics3000
  Total Credits210924
III-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S601PCCompiler Design4004
2CS602PCWeb Technologies4004
3CS603PCCryptography and Network Security4004
4 Open Elective-II3003
5CS611PE
CS612PE
CS613PE
CS614PE
CS615PE
Professional Elective-I
Mobile Computing
Design Patterns
Artificial Intelligence
Information Security Management (Security Analyst – I)
Introduction to Analytics (Associate Analytics – I)
3003
6CS604PCCryptography and Network Security Lab0032
7CS605PCWeb Technologies Lab0032
8EN606HSAdvanced English Communication Skills Lab0032
  Total Credits180924
IV-YEAR I-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1CS701PCDATA MINING4004
2CS702PCPrinciples of Programming Languages4004
3CS721PE
CS722PE
CS723PE
CS724PE
Professional Elective-II
Python Programming
Mobile Application Development
Web Scripting Languages
Internet of Things
3003
4CS731PE
CS732PE
CS733PE
CS734PE
Professional Elective-III
Graph Theory
Distributed Systems
Machine Learning
Software Process and Project Management
3003
5CS741PE
CS742PE
CS743PE
CS744PE
Professional Elective-IV
Computational Complexity
Cloud Computing
Blockchain Technology
Social Network Analysis
3003
6CS703PCData Mining Lab0032
7CS751PE
CS752PE
CS753PE
CS754PE
PE-II Lab #
Python Programming Lab
Mobile Application Development Lab
Web Scripting Languages Lab
Internet of Things Lab
0032
8CS705PCIndustry Oriented Mini Project0032
9CS706PCSeminar0021
  Total Credits1701124
IV-YEAR II-SEMESTER
S. No.Course CodeCourse TitleLTPCredits
1 Open Elective – III3003
2CS851PE
CS852PE
CS853PE
CS854PE
Professional Elective-V
Information Theory & Coding
Real-Time Systems
Data Analytics
Modern Software Engineering
3003
3CS861PE
CS862PE
CS863PE
CS864PE
Professional Elective-VI
Advanced Algorithms
Web Services and Service Oriented Architecture
Computer Forensics
Neural Networks and Deep Learning
3003
4CS801PCMajor Project003015
  Total Credits903024